Job description





NOOKSACK INDIAN TRIBE 

   JOB DESCRIPTION






Job Title:Tribal Gaming Agent

Department:Nooksack Tribal Gaming Agency (TGA)

Reports To:Tribal Gaming Agency Director

Job Status: Regular Full Time – (Rotating Shift – Days, Nights, Weekends & Holidays)

Type: Non-Exempt (Hourly

Grade:E – 1

JOB SUMMARY:

Represents the Nooksack Tribal Gaming Commission (NTGC) in a highly professional manner at all times. Monitors the gaming operation to ensure compliance with NTGC operating policy and procedures preserves and protects the assets of the Nooksack Indian Tribe and ensure the integrity of the gaming operation and experience. Monitors and ensures compliance with the Tribal Gaming Ordinance and Regulations, Tribal – State Compact.

MAJOR TASKS AND RESPONSIBILITIES:

  1. Ensures regulatory compliance with all applicable Tribal, Federal and Statelawsand regulations by monitoring,observing,reportingand takingappropriate action.
  1. Detect and investigate regulatory issues, including but not limited to game protection, rule of play, and irregularities and relevant laws.
  1. Reviews existing and proposed regulations, controls, policies and standards for adherence and compliance with Federal, State and Tribal requirements.
  1. Performs audits on operations todeterminecompliance with system of internal controls and regulations.
  1. Assistin investigating and documenting variances,shortagesand exceptions.
  1. Utilize andmaintainsystems, logs and other means to track and report gaming incidents and activities that are not normal to the operation or are in violation of specific gaming procedures and regulations.
  1. Enforce applicable law whilemaintaina positive relationship with thoseimpacted. Maintain positive relations with employees, management, outside organizations and/or agencies.
  1. Examines, test and inspect gaming equipment on a random basis asdeterminedby the director.
  1. Conducts barring of unwanted patrons.
  1. Observes the conduct of games to ensure honesty and fairness to the patron as well as the Tribe.
  1. Assistin loss prevention in reference to Tribal assets.
  1. Responsible for monitoring the counting, verifying, and recording the contents of various income sources by the Nooksack Tribal Casino’s Count Teams in accordance with the Tribal Internal Control System (TICS) for the Drop and Count, and transferring of the funds in the Cage Department accountability. Monitor the Count Team members whoare responsible forensuring that theappropriate countdocuments are completed and provided to the Accounting Department for purposes of auditing. Responsible for reporting on compliance of employees, manager, and supervisors of the Nooksack Tribal Gaming Enterprises with all applicable laws, rules, regulations, policies,proceduresand professional standards of conduct.
